RCB vs SRH: Bangalore keeps their hope alive for the Playoffs

Royal Challengers Bangalore (RCB) clinched a humdinger of a match to keep themselves alive in the Indian Premier League (IPL 2018) with a 14-run win over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) in their final home game at the M Chinnaswamy Stadium in Bengaluru on Thursday.
